在Oracle中,可以將to_number函數與其他函數結合使用,以轉換字符串為數字并執行其他操作。以下是一些常見的示例:
SELECT SUM(TO_NUMBER(column_name))
FROM table_name;
SELECT DECODE(column_name, 'value1', TO_NUMBER('1'), 'value2', TO_NUMBER('2'), TO_NUMBER('0'))
FROM table_name;
SELECT CASE
WHEN column_name = 'value1' THEN TO_NUMBER('1')
WHEN column_name = 'value2' THEN TO_NUMBER('2')
ELSE TO_NUMBER('0')
END
FROM table_name;
這些示例展示了如何將to_number函數與其他函數結合使用,實現對字符串轉換為數字并進行其他操作的功能。通過靈活運用Oracle的函數和語句,可以實現更加復雜和多樣化的數據處理操作。